Some of the most important things … Web6 mei 2024 · Brush your puppy once a week using a soft-bristled brush. This will keep his coat healthy and sleek. At this time, you should also check his paws to make sure his nails are short and the pads aren't damaged. Check between each toe for raw or red spots and look over his skin for lumps or bumps.

Web12 nov. 2024 · Pick up any shoes, books, or other items that could easily be reached by your puppy. 3. Buy a gate and/or a crate. A baby gate is useful for confining your puppy to certain areas of your home, at least initially. Crates are good for sleeping and keeping your puppy safe while you leave the home for brief periods. To put it all together: Prepare your current dog for the new addition to their canine family by providing the puppy scent and setting up a puppy zone. Have a neutral place for your dogs to meet and keep tasty treats on hand. Provide a barrier that allows nose-to-nose sniffs.
